What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To learn about the relevance of freestyle trap beats, it's essential to first break down what a freestyle beat actually is. In basic terms, a freestyle beat is an critical track that is made for musicians to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written verses or tunes. It's suggested to influence off-the-cuff efficiencies, motivating rap artists to supply spontaneous and often much more raw, moving verses.

A freestyle type beat varies somewhat from a routine instrumental in that it's structured in a way that gives musicians area to take a breath. These beats commonly have fewer melodic components, leaving room for complex flows and powerful wordplay. They're at the same time commonly much more repetitive than traditional track instrumentals, making sure that the rapper or vocalist can quickly discover their groove and ride the beat without obtaining lost in complex setups.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Now, within the dimension of freestyle beats, there is a specific part known as freestyle trap beat. Trap songs, originating from the southerly United States, is defined by large use 808 bass drums, fast h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able melodies. It's a noise that has actually grown in appeal over the years, becoming one of one of the most prominent styles in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ature features and fuse them with the liberty and versatility of freestyle beats, causing a impressive blending. These beats are perfect for artists seeking to bring power and aggressiveness to their verses while still preserving the flexibility to discover various circulations and styles.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Symbol

Amongst the many variants of freestyle trap beats, the DaBaby type beat has turned into one of one of the most in-demand. DaBaby type beats are inspired by the trademark audio of the North Carolina rap artist DaBaby, recognized for his rapid-fire distribution, catchy hooks, and hard-hitting manufacturing. These beats normally feature quick tempos,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et aggressive melodies, making them ideal for high-energy freestyle performances.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So Well for Freestyles

1. Fast Paces: The quick pace of a DaBaby type beat motivates rap artists to supply rapid-fire flows, compeling them to believe on their feet and push their lyrical boundaries.
2. Basic Yet Memorable Melodies: Unlike some trap beats that can be extremely complex, DaBaby type beats are frequently built around straightforward, repeated tunes that leave space for the rap artist's vocals to beam.
3. Potent Drums: The hostile percussion in these beats includes an component of necessity, driving the musician to match the beat's strength with their verses.

Whether you're a follower of DaBaby's music or otherwise, there's no denying the influence his sound has had on modern-day freestyle culture. The DaBaby type beat is a staple in the freestyle beat universe, providing trap artists a platform to display their speed, precision, and charisma.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ers offer free of charge use, generally for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be utilized for trials, freestyles, and social networks web content, musicians usually require to pay for a certificate if they wish to launch the song commercially (i.e., on streaming systems or to buy).

This model has been a game-changer, enabling young artists to experiment with their sound, practice their freestyling, and build an online presence without having to stress over production costs.

How to Find the Perfect Freestyle Trap Beat.

With a lot of possibilities available, going for the right freestyle trap beat can feel difficult. Below are some essential variables to consider when looking for the ideal beat:.

1. The Bpm (Beats per Minute)

The Bpm of a beat will certainly determine the overall feel of your freestyle. Freestyle type beats with rapid paces are ideal for high-energy performances, while slower tempos offer you more space to explore various circulations and lyrical motifs. Consider your style and how comfortable you are freestyling at various rates before selecting a beat.

2. Intricacy.

Some beats are much more complicated than others, featuring a vast selection of sounds, melodies, and transitions. While complex beats can add enjoyment to a track, they might likewise make it tougher to freestyle over. Less complex freestyle beats instrumental freestyle beats are commonly much easier to collaborate with, as they provide a empty canvas for your lyrics.

3. Mood and Vibe.

The mood of the beat should match the message or power you intend to share. Freestyle trap beats usually have dark, moody touches, but there are also more uplifting or ariose options offered. Pay attention to a selection of beats and select one that resonates with your imaginative vision.

4. Experience with the Sound.

Particular types of beats, like the DaBaby type beat, are made to deal with particular flows and rap designs. If you fit rapping over quickly, compelling instrumentals, this might be the very best alternative for you. However, if you like a more easygoing solution, seek a free kind beat or freestyle beat with a slower, extra kicked back tone.
